Review: Will You Dance, Miss Laurence? by Raven McAllen

Title: Will You Dance, Miss Laurence?
Author: Raven McAllan
Series: Dance Studio, #1
Release Date: March 15th 2013
Publisher: Evernight Publishing
Genre: Erotic Romance
Rating: 3.5 Hoots
Reviewer: Charity

Summary:
Dancing lessons were supposed to be fun, but who ever heard of attending them without your knickers on?

Shibari Master Ryan is intrigued by Ava, so when his cousin asks a favor, he is only too happy to help Ava out of the rut she says she is in.

Will her past allow her to enjoy his bondage, or will true submission prove a step too much? (Goodreads)

Review:
The idea behind Will You Dance, Miss Laurence is good, the interaction between the characters was good. The flow was steady and the climax was a surprise. I gobbled this story up in one sitting so my attention was definitely held. Why the 3.5 rating….I really struggled with the rating because of nitpicky things that really irritated me.  

First, the HEA seemed forced and unnatural. What MS. Laurence feels is lust and release of fear, by no means is it love. What Ryan feels is appreciation for her ability to try and of course lust. So why the author felt we must wrap up with an HEA is beyond me, the making love scene was BS and did not feel real.

Then there is Ms. Laurence’s seeming naivety of BDSM, but her obvious dealings with it in the past. The climaxes reveal and then as quick as lightening she overcomes the fear. It’s all unbelievable, even though I wanted it for her- to recover from her trauma.

Other details like—how does her best friend not know who her husband was? Then I see that this is the first book in a series, why, the story is wrapped up in my opinion and I see no opening for additional characters because “The Dance Studio” is not a real place.

Sorry, rant is over now. I do not feel I wasted my time because I did enjoy the story to some extent it just wasn’t great.
